Solar Freezer Market size was valued at USD 10.5 billion in 2023 and is poised to grow from USD 11.22 billion in 2024 to USD 19.14 billion by 2032, growing at a CAGR of 6.9% during the forecast period (2025-2032).
The global solar freezer market is experiencing robust growth, driven by a rising focus on sustainable and off-grid solutions. These eco-friendly freezers, which utilize solar energy for cooling, are increasingly popular across various sectors such as healthcare, agriculture, and food storage, particularly in remote areas lacking reliable electricity access. Market expansion is supported by heightened awareness of renewable energy, favorable government initiatives, and a pressing demand for dependable cold storage options in underserved regions. Additionally, technological advancements have resulted in more efficient and cost-effective solar freezer systems. However, challenges such as high initial investment costs and geographic limitations may hinder broader adoption. Overall, the solar freezer market is set to grow, addressing environmental concerns while meeting essential needs across diverse industries.

Driver of the Solar Freezer Market
The Solar Freezer market is experiencing significant growth driven by the expanding healthcare facilities sector globally. There is a notable increase in the demand for pharmaceutical products, necessitating effective storage solutions for vaccines, drugs, and blood bags. Medical institutions are increasingly adopting solar freezers as a reliable means to ensure proper storage for these critical items. Additionally, the escalating need for cold storage, particularly for vaccines, has prompted various regions to seek innovative solutions. In India, the government has initiated collaborative programs with multinational corporations like Tata and Rockwell, along with start-ups, to enhance cold storage capacities for the safe transportation and storage of vaccines.
Restraints in the Solar Freezer Market
One of the significant restraints impacting the growth of the global solar freezer market is the high cost associated with solar freezer technology. The substantial initial investment required for these units restricts accessibility for many potential consumers. While financing options are available for larger users, the overall expense remains a barrier for wider adoption. Additionally, the installation of photovoltaic components necessitates considerable financial resources, further escalating costs. The construction of portable freezers also contributes to the high expenditure, ultimately hindering the expansion of the solar freezer market as affordability remains a critical challenge for prospective buyers.
Market Trends of the Solar Freezer Market
The Solar Freezer market is witnessing a significant trend towards the integration of IoT and smart technologies, transforming these devices from mere cooling solutions into sophisticated, connected systems. With the incorporation of IoT-enabled sensors and data analytics, users can benefit from real-time performance monitoring, precise temperature control, and proactive maintenance alerts. These advancements enhance operational efficiency, minimize energy waste, and cater to the needs of remote and off-grid users. As demand for interconnected and intelligent appliances rises alongside the push for sustainability, manufacturers are prioritizing innovative solutions, ensuring solar freezers meet the evolving expectations of environmentally conscious consumers.
